Paclobutrazol, a highly effective Plant Growth Regulator, has become a valuable tool in modern agriculture. Known for inhibiting gibberellin biosynthesis, paclobutrazol helps regulate plant growth, improve crop quality, and enhance yields. Particularly useful in vegetable crops, fruits, and even ornamental plants, paclobutrazol 23% SC offers farmers a versatile solution to manage crop growth while promoting sustainable practices.
Proper application techniques are essential to achieving the best results with paclobutrazol. This blog outlines seven best practices for ensuring its optimal use in farming.
1. Understand the Role of Paclobutrazol in AgriculturePaclobutrazol slows excessive vegetative growth, directing the plant’s energy toward flowering, fruiting, and root development. This makes it particularly beneficial for fruit crops like mangoes, apples, and vegetables such as tomatoes and peppers.

Timing is crucial when applying paclobutrazol. The ideal application period depends on the crop and its growth stage. Applying paclobutrazol during the pre-flowering or early fruit-setting stage ensures optimal results for fruit crops. For vegetables, it’s best to use it during the active growth phase to redirect energy to reproductive growth.
Timing Guidelines:Mangoes: Apply during the pre-flowering stage to induce uniform flowering and fruiting.
Tomatoes and Peppers: Apply after initial vegetative growth to boost flowering and fruit formation.

3. Use the Correct DosageOver-application of paclobutrazol can lead to stunted growth, while under-application may not deliver the desired results. Always follow the recommended dosage guidelines on the product label or consult an agricultural expert for tailored advice.
Dosage Tips:Use a calibrated sprayer to ensure accurate application.
Dilute paclobutrazol 23% SC appropriately to prevent over-concentration, which could stress the crop.
Achieving uniform coverage ensures that all plants in the field benefit equally from the treatment. Inconsistent application can lead to uneven growth, reducing the overall efficacy of paclobutrazol.
Techniques for Uniform Application:Use equipment like boom sprayers or knapsack sprayers for even distribution.
Apply on a calm day to prevent drift and ensure the solution reaches the intended target.

5. Combine with Integrated Farming PracticesPaclobutrazol works best when integrated into a broader farming strategy. Combining it with proper irrigation, fertilization, and pest management practices ensures that plants have the nutrients and conditions needed to maximize their potential.
Examples:Pair paclobutrazol application with drip irrigation to ensure the solution reaches the root zone efficiently.
Use organic fertilizers alongside paclobutrazol to maintain soil health while enhancing crop yield.
After applying paclobutrazol, closely monitor the crop’s growth to ensure it responds as expected. Signs of effectiveness include controlled vegetative growth, enhanced flowering, and better fruit set. If there are any issues, adjust future applications accordingly.
Monitoring Tips:Keep detailed records of application dates, dosages, and crop responses.
Look for any signs of overuse, such as excessive stunting, and adjust accordingly.
While paclobutrazol is effective, its application must align with safety guidelines to protect the environment and the farmer. Ensure proper handling and disposal of any leftover solution.
Safety Measures:Wear protective gear, including gloves and goggles, during application.
Avoid applying paclobutrazol near water bodies to prevent Water contamination.
